AD1147 by Analog Devices

AD1147 by Analog Devices is a 16-bit D/A converter with max output voltage of ±10 V, linearity error of 0.0008%, and settling time of 20 us. Ideal for applications requiring precise analog signal generation in industrial automation, test equipment, and instrumentation.
